Netflix Pulls the Plug on Texas Drama 'Ransom Canyon' Following Two Seasons

Netflix has decided not to renew the romantic drama 'Ransom Canyon' for a third season. The series, starring Josh Duhamel and Minka Kelly, premiered its second season in July and followed three ranching families in a small Texas town. The cancellation also affects hundreds of local production workers in New Mexico who were employed during filming.

The series, created by April Blair, centered on three ranching families in Texas Hill Country. Its ensemble cast included Duhamel and Kelly alongside Lizzy Greene, Garrett Wareing, Marianly Tejada, Jack Schumacher, Casey W. Johnson, Philip Winchester, and Justin Johnson Cortez. The second season, released in July, consisted of eight episodes and continued the intertwined stories of Staten Kirkland and Quinn O'Grady.

The decision also carries significant economic consequences for New Mexico's production sector. During the second season's filming in 2025, the show hired over 700 local residents, comprising 380 crew members, 40 principal actors, and 300 background actors. State film officials had previously highlighted the production as a testament to New Mexico's growing capacity for long-term series work.

The cancellation could have a tangible ripple effect on regional entertainment economies, particularly in New Mexico, where hundreds of local crew members and extras may face sudden employment gaps. It also reflects the broader volatility of the streaming market, where even established genre shows with recognizable leads may struggle to secure long-term commitments.
